Job Posting Organization: The Asian Development Bank (ADB) is an international development finance institution that was established in 1966 and is headquartered in Manila, Philippines. ADB is composed of 69 member countries, with 50 of them located in the Asia and Pacific region. The organization is dedicated to achieving a prosperous, inclusive, resilient, and sustainableAsia and the Pacific, while also focusing on eradicating extreme poverty. ADB combines finance, knowledge, and partnerships to fulfill its expanded vision under its Strategy 2030, which aims to address the region's most pressing challenges. Duties and Responsibilities: The duties and responsibilities of the Senior Project Assistant include:
Contributing to the preparation and updating of the Project Administration Manual (PAM) by gathering and consolidating relevant data and drafting various sections.
Preparing and updating individual Project Performance Reports (PPR) monthly, detailing project descriptions, implementation status, developments, and major issues.
Compiling data on contract awards and disbursements for assigned projects and generating reports for departmental and management review.
Monitoring actual awards and disbursements against targets, identifying shortfalls, and following up with executing agencies.
Maintaining records to monitor compliance with project and technical assistance covenants and inputting data into the INRM database.
Monitoring physical progress in project implementation and following up on outstanding obligations of executing agencies.
Assisting in updating procurement plans, reviewing procurement documents, and drafting responses on procurement matters.
Reviewing withdrawal applications for compliance with project agreements. 1
